  • Abstract
    This paper established Galerkin Finite element method coupled with Newmark Beta time integration method to analyze Winkler foundation subjected to a harmonic moving load on a uniform Bernoulli – Euler Beam. MATLAB software was used to implement the Newmark time integration method to obtain the Analysis. The deflection of the Beam increase when the acceleration of the load was change from am2=2m/s^2 to am=15m/s^2 . Also when the position of the load was change from n=5 to n=10. It was observed from the results that the position of the load and the acceleration of the moving load affect the deflection of the Beam.
